Abstract

The ascidian Styela clava is an invasive species that easily colonizes new water areas and has a wide distribution. A previously undescribed typhlosole was discovered in S. clava and studied using histological techniques, transmission electron microscopy and computer microtomography. The typhlosole is a large fold of the dorsal intestinal wall that starts in the lower quarter of the stomach and continues to the rectum. Its shape varies greatly: from a rounded protrusion to a spirally twisted fold. The typhlosole is formed by the intestinal epithelium and a thick connective tissue layer, in which pyloric tubules and blood vessels are extended. The epithelium consists of glandular, ciliated, and nonciliated cells demonstrating apocrine secretion. The typhlosole intensifies the food digestion and absorption of nutrients. The features observed in the typhlosole may contribute to a high digestion efficiency even in low-productive waters, determining the biological success of this species.
